Where the sponsor answer actually stalls.

Not for want of science. The work has been validated and the answer written before. It is sitting in a past proposal or in a scientific director's head while the RFP clock runs.

  • 01

    The proposals floor

    Every RFP rebuild starts from old proposals and staff memory. First-pass answers to repeat questions — assay menus, turnaround, kit composition, data integration — consume senior scientific time.

    That time should be going to the fraction of each bid that actually differentiates. Instead it goes to answers that already exist somewhere.

    Scarce scientist time spent on the questions that recur.

  • 02

    Scientific knowledge across regions

    Assay and study knowledge is deep and scarce. When a tenured project manager or lab director is unavailable, sponsor answers stall.

    Specimen stability, kit shelf life, a regional testing difference — three regions give three versions of one answer, and on standardized global testing the sponsor can see the difference.

    The variance is visible to the person deciding.

  • 03

    Quality, compliance and data

    Security, regulatory and data-handling questionnaires arrive in a new wrapper from every sponsor and CRO, consuming senior QA time on repeat answers.

    Blinded data management, chain of custody, accreditation posture, customs and distribution rules — the required language exists but is not reliably delivered in every response.

    For a business whose currency is trial integrity, a stale answer is a study risk.

What people ask

Some are worth putting to your own team first.

How does this handle questions that genuinely need a scientist?

It routes them. First-pass answers are drawn from approved sources with the citation attached; anything new, sensitive or below the confidence threshold goes to the accountable expert before it ships. The target is that experts see the 10–20% that needs judgement rather than reviewing every answer, which is what makes the review sustainable rather than heroic.

Can it keep answers consistent across regions?

That is the main reason to do it. Every region draws on the same approved source, so the answer does not depend on which office received the question. When a stability figure, an accreditation or a data-handling rule changes, you change it once and it applies on the next response everywhere.

What about blinded and sponsor-sensitive material?

Sources are permissioned on intake, so access follows the permissions you already set rather than becoming a second, looser copy of them. That is also the argument against staff pasting sponsor context into consumer AI tools, which is the confidentiality exposure most quality teams are actually worried about.

How is this different from keeping a proposal library?

A library stores answers. It does not know which are stale, which contradict a current validation package, or which were edited after review last time. Tribble drafts from approved sources with the source, owner and version visible, and folds reviewer edits back in, so the next sponsor's RFP starts ahead rather than from zero.

What do we need before starting?

Past proposals, assay menus and validation summaries, QA and regulatory language, project records — in whatever form they exist. There is no migration. What matters more is naming who signs off on a scientific claim, a data commitment and a compliance statement.
